首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Java:用逗号格式化数字

Java中可以使用DecimalFormat类来格式化数字,其中逗号是常用的格式化符号之一。下面是完善且全面的答案:

Java中的逗号格式化数字是指在数字中插入逗号,以提高数字的可读性。逗号格式化通常用于货币、金融和统计数据的展示。

在Java中,可以使用DecimalFormat类来实现逗号格式化。DecimalFormat类是java.text包中的一个类,它提供了各种格式化数字的方法。

以下是一个示例代码,演示如何使用逗号格式化数字:

代码语言:txt
复制
import java.text.DecimalFormat;

public class Main {
    public static void main(String[] args) {
        double number = 1234567.89;

        DecimalFormat decimalFormat = new DecimalFormat("#,###.00");
        String formattedNumber = decimalFormat.format(number);

        System.out.println("Formatted Number: " + formattedNumber);
    }
}

输出结果为:

代码语言:txt
复制
Formatted Number: 1,234,567.89

在上面的示例中,我们首先创建了一个DecimalFormat对象,并指定了格式模式#,###.00。其中#表示可选的数字位,逗号表示插入逗号,0表示必须存在的数字位。然后,我们使用format()方法将数字格式化为字符串。

逗号格式化数字在以下场景中非常有用:

  1. 货币和金融应用:在金融应用中,逗号格式化可以使金额更易读,提高用户体验。
  2. 统计数据展示:在统计数据中,逗号格式化可以使大数字更易于理解和比较。
  3. 数据报表:在生成数据报表时,逗号格式化可以使数据更易读,方便分析和决策。

腾讯云提供了多种与Java开发相关的产品和服务,以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):提供可扩展的云服务器实例,支持Java应用程序的部署和运行。产品介绍链接
  2. 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务,适用于Java应用程序的数据存储。产品介绍链接
  3. 云函数(SCF):无服务器计算服务,支持Java函数的编写和执行。产品介绍链接
  4. 云存储(COS):提供高可靠、低成本的对象存储服务,适用于Java应用程序的文件存储和访问。产品介绍链接

以上是关于Java中逗号格式化数字的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券